Introduction

Understanding the distinctions between qualitative and quantitative research is fundamental for conducting and evaluating research effectively in psychology and related fields. Quantitative research involves the collection and analysis of numerical data to identify patterns, relationships, or causal effects, while qualitative research focuses on understanding phenomena through non-numeric data such as texts, interviews, or observations. Methodological Differences

The core distinction hinges on data type: quantitative studies utilize structured measurements and statistical analysis, aiming for objectivity and generalizability. In contrast, qualitative research embraces open-ended data collection methods to produce detailed, contextually rich descriptions. Quantitative research tests hypotheses through measurement and statistical inference, while qualitative research generates theories or explanations grounded in participant perspectives.

Strengths and Limitations

Quantitative methods excel in assessing the magnitude of effects and establishing general patterns across larger populations. However, they may overlook nuanced contexts and individual differences. Qualitative approaches provide comprehensive understanding of complex phenomena but often involve smaller sample sizes and limited generalizability. Recognizing these strengths and limitations informs researchers' choice of method based on study objectives.

Applications in Practice

In applied psychology and research settings, quantitative methods are suited for evaluating intervention efficacy or testing hypotheses across populations, such as assessing a new therapy technique’s impact on symptom reduction. Conversely, qualitative methods are invaluable in exploratory studies, understanding patient experiences, or developing new theories, such as investigating barriers to mental health service utilization. An integrated approach combining both methods can offer a comprehensive understanding of research questions.
